Begin by setting clear, measurable milestones that break the year into manageable phases. This prevents feeling overwhelmed and creates regular checkpoints to adjust course. Pair goals with systems—like time-blocking, habit trackers, or automated reminders—so progress feels natural, not forced.

Energy management is equally crucial. Prioritize rest, nutrition, and mental recovery just as seriously as task completion. Research shows that consistent small wins, supported by rest and reflection, lead to higher retention than intense bursts followed by burnout.
Across American households and workplaces, people are shifting from short-term hustle to steady, incremental change. Rising cost-of-living pressures, evolving workplace expectations, and a heightened focus on work-life balance have amplified interest in sustainable progress.
